Transaction 4f4a66de28fab031d5ab4b274f78ef91b533beb1419af808d98e6e9aee4de3a6

1 Input
1 Outputs
  • 4f4a66de28fab031d5ab4b274f78ef91b533beb1419af808d98e6e9aee4de3a6:0
  • value  8975282
    address  37rMdnFMqJMiexqb4VwucPxDyXGefe8679